A pharmacy, pharmacy department or depot must be conducted in premises that have been approved by the Board.

Criteria for approval
The Board assesses applications for compliance with the planning requirements set out in the Pharmacy Board of Victoria Guidelines for Good Pharmaceutical Practice (Part 6 - Pharmacies and Pharmacy Departments).

To establish a new pharmacy department or relocate or alter an existing pharmacy department
Pharmacists should lodge an ‘Application for Approval of Pharmacy Department Premises‘

To establish a new pharmacy or relocate or alter an existing pharmacy
Pharmacists should lodge an ‘Application for Approval of Pharmacy Premises‘

To establish a pharmacy depot
Pharmacists should lodge an ‘Application for Approval of a Pharmacy Depot‘


A person must have the prior approval of the Board to:
- establish a new pharmacy business or pharmacy department, or
- buy an existing pharmacy business or a partnership in an existing pharmacy business, or
- relocate an existing pharmacy business, or
- assume control of a pharmacy department, or
- relocate an existing pharmacy department.

Section 107(1) of the Health Professions Registration Act 2005
A pharmacist shall not supply, compound or dispense except
(a) from a pharmacy or pharmacy department  that is approved by the Board (refer Approval of premises); or
(b) in any other special circumstances that are approved by the Board in a particular case.

Criteria for approval
The Board assesses applications on the basis of the public need and compliance with the relevant standards of practice

To obtain approval to supply, compound or dispense in special circumstances
Pharmacists should lodge a written application setting out the special circumstances (‘Application for Approval to Supply, Compound or Dispense in Special Circumstances pursuant to section 107(1)(b) of the Health Professions Registration Act 2005‘)
